Royal Portrush, Omni Barton Creek, Golf Rivals, Adidas, and Great Waters announced as winners of Golf Aficionado Magazine Best of 2019 Awards

Each year our editorial staff gets together to award the Best Golf Course of The Year, the Best Golf Product of The Year, The Best Golf Resort of The Year, The Best Golf App of The Year, and The Best New Golf Course of The Year

ORLANDO, Fla. - ncarol.com -- Full Award List

Best Golf Course
Winner of the 2019 Best Golf Course award is the Dunluce Course at Royal Portrush, one of the crown jewels of Northern Ireland. The Dunluce Course at Royal Portrush played host to the 148th Open Championship in 2019 and was the star of the tournament. Featuring a spectacular course layout that includes new holes and an adjusted course routing, Royal Portrush is better than ever. The Dunluce Course at Royal Portrush earned our highest course rating in 2019 and currently holds the number 1 spot in our Top 10 rankings.

Best Golf Product
Winner of the 2019 Best Golf Product award is Adidas with their ForgeFiber BOA golf shoes.  Everyone likes a new pair of shoes, but Adidas blew us away with the overall fit, comfort, and performance of the golf shoes. After testing multiple pairs of shoes throughout the year, the Adidas ForgeFiber BOA golf shoes drastically outperformed all other shoes on the market in all categories.

Best Golf App
Winner of the 2019 Best Golf App award is Golf Rival.  We're all guilty of spending too much time on our phones, and Golf Rival only multiples the problem.  This Player Vs. Player golf app is the most addictive we've ever seen.  When you can't get out on the golf course, you can always turn to Golf Rival to play a few holes against friends or other players from around the world.  Try it out, but don't see we didn't warn you that it's addictive!

Best Golf Resort
Winner of the 2019 Best Golf Resort award is Omni Barton Creek.  This May Omni Barton Creek reopened following a $150 million renovation.  Money well spent, the resort at Omni Barton Creek, is modern, sophisticated, and oh so luxurious.  Omni Barton Creek features four 18-hole championship golf courses sure to challenge and please golfers of all abilities.  Located in the heart of Austin, Texas Omni Barton Creek is the place to spend your next golf holiday!

Best New Golf Course
Winner of the 2019 Best New Golf Course award is the Great Waters course at Reynolds Lake Oconee.  Reopened in October following an 18-month renovation, Jack Nicklaus and his design team did one heck of a job taking a great course and making it extraordinary!
